11.5% of heterozygous border follicle cell clusters show defects in migration.

The dendrites of ddaE neurons overextend in Tm102299/Tm1S130510 transheterozygotes and Tm102299 homozygotes.

Homozygous larvae have a defect in head morphogenesis, the pharynx is not retracted into the body during head involution. A protruding pharyngeal mass means individuals cannot feed due to an inability to suck food into the mouth atrium. Embryos lacking maternal Tm1 are defective in pole cell formation.

The mild indirect muscle phenotype seen in DAAMEx1 mutants is not altered by Tm102299/+.

Expression of psidinScer\UAS.cKa under the control of Scer\GAL4slbo.2.6 in a Tm102299 heterozygous background results in border cell migration defects (26.7%).

The amount of blistering and crumpling of wings in flies expressing MYPT-75DF117A.Scer\UAS under the control of Scer\GAL4Bx-MS1096 is suppressed by Tm102299.

Dominantly enhances the frequency of br1 mutant animals with malformed legs.

Abolishes expression of cytoplasmic isoform but does not affect muscle isoforms.

Mobilisation of the P{PZ} element resulted in reversion of the feeding defect, larvae develop into normal adults. Lack of zygotic Tm1 results in the specific head defect, lack of maternal Tm1 affects germ cell formation.
